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4

The NM_001122838.3(NAPEPLD):​c.823C>T​(p.Pro275Ser)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000342 in 1,461,874 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
NAPEPLD (HGNC:21683): (N-acyl phosphatidylethanolamine phospholipase D) NAPEPLD is a phospholipase D type enzyme that catalyzes the release of N-acylethanolamine (NAE) from N-acyl-phosphatidylethanolamine (NAPE) in the second step of the biosynthesis of N-acylethanolamine (Okamoto et al., 2004 [PubMed 14634025]).[supplied by OMIM, Oct 2008]

The c.823C>T (p.P275S) alteration is located in exon 3 (coding exon 2) of the NAPEPLD gene. This alteration results from a C to T substitution at nucleotide position 823, causing the proline (P) at amino acid position 275 to be replaced by a serine (S).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
